When will a jury reduce a murder to a voluntary manslaughter based on heat of passion?

California, United States of America


The following excerpt is from People v. Beyer, F071055 (Cal. App. 2017):

When supported by substantial evidence, jury instructions on the reduction of murder to voluntary manslaughter based on heat of passion must be given with or without a request. (People v. Moye (2009) 47 Cal.4th 537, 548.)
